Мазмуну:

C# менен LogManager деген эмне?
C# менен LogManager деген эмне?

Video: C# менен LogManager деген эмне?

Video: C# менен LogManager деген эмне?
Video: Flowgorythm аркылуу C# Sharp Develop менен баштоо 2024, Май
Anonim

LogManager журналдоо алкагынын конфигурациялоо касиеттерин сактоо жана бардык аталган Logger объекттеринин иерархиялык аттар мейкиндигин башкаруу үчүн колдонулат.

Анын C# тилинде log4net деген эмне?

Log4net мүмкүндүк берет ачык булак китепкана болуп саналат. NET тиркемелери аркылуу ар кандай булактарга (мисалы, консол, SMTP же файлдар) чыгууну киргизүү үчүн. Log4net Java-да колдонулган популярдуу log4J китепканасынын порту.

NLog C# деген эмне? NLog болуп саналат. Колдонмоңуз үчүн жогорку сапаттагы журналдарды кошууга мүмкүндүк берген Net Library. NLog ошондой эле Visual Studio'до Nugget аркылуу жүктөп алса болот. Максаттар. Максаттар журнал билдирүүлөрүн башка көздөгөн жерге көрсөтүү, сактоо же өткөрүү үчүн колдонулат.

Кошумчалай кетсек, C# тилинде логгердин кандай пайдасы бар?

Обзор. Logger болуп саналат колдонулган ыңгайлаштырылган ката журналынын файлдарын түзүү үчүн же ката администратордун машинасындагы Windows окуялар журналында журнал жазуусу катары катталышы мүмкүн. Бул макалада текстке негизделген ката журналы файлын жана өзүңүздүн форматыңыз менен ката билдирүүлөрүн кантип түзүү керектиги көрсөтүлөт. C# класс.

Log4netти кантип орнотом?

Баштоо: Nuget аркылуу log4netти кантип орнотуу керек

  1. log4net пакетин кошуңуз. Log4net менен баштоо Nuget пакетин орнотуу сыяктуу оңой.
  2. log4net кошуу. конфигурация файлы.
  3. Log4netке конфигурацияңызды жүктөө үчүн айтыңыз. Кийинки биз log4netке анын конфигурациясын кайдан жүктөш керектигин айтып, ал чындап иштеши керек.
  4. Log Something!

Сунушталууда: